Week 3: Cuddling Cows

On a cold Saturday, I went to a dairy farm in Ravels (Belgium) that offers special cow cuddling sessions. The farm is still active and produces milk, but alongside this main activity, the farmer and his wife want to bridge the gap between farm-life and everyday people.

Upon arrival, we were given overalls and boots to put on. When in the stables, we heard all about numbers, legislation, and the hard work involved. I learned a lot, even though I am an engineer in biosciences and am not a complete layperson.

Afterwards, we were allowed to go into the stable to cuddle with the cows. How much fun that was for little Freia! Feeling the warmth of their bodies, and how calm they were. I could touch them, and even lean on them. However, some cows didn’t seem to feel like cuddling, as they just walked away.

The joy I felt from that experience lasted for more than a week.

The farmers are perfectly willing to give the tour in English, although their website is in Dutch:
